What is Trends in Alcoholic Liver Disease Research - Clinical and Scientific Aspects about?
Alcoholic Liver Disease Occurs After Prolonged Heavy Drinking. Not Everyone Who Drinks Alcohol In Excess Develops Serious Forms Of Alcoholic Liver Disease. It Is Likely That Genetic Factors Determine This Individual Susceptibility, And A Family History Of Chronic Liver Disease May Indicate A Higher Risk. Other Factors Include Being Overweight And Iron Overload. This Book Presents State-of-the-art Information Summarizing The Current Understanding Of A Range Of Alcoholic Liver Diseases.
